I've always wondered about the font used in the date on this 1924 rouble (and on the 50 Kopek -Poltina- as well).

It looks as though the engraver originally designed '1994' and corrected the second '9' into '2' subsequently.

Two french francs minted in brass for the "Chambres de Commerce de France" dated 1924. Whereas France continued to mint silver coinage during WW I and even upto 1920, they failed to maintain price stability in the postwar period. Silver coins were hoarded and the country suddenly found itself without change. The "chambers of commerce" brass coinage was meant to be a "temporary patch" (hence the inscciption "bon pour"), however they have been circulating far longer than expected.
